stitchdup Posted December 31, 2016 Share Posted December 31, 2016 Finished this today. It's the Imax kit with revell corvette wheels. Made up some airbags to replace the kit springs, used thread to do a mexican blanket interior, lace paint on the roof, lowered until the tyres hit the tops of the fenders and wired the engine. The roof and glass dont fit very well on this kit, and to even get the top on the interior tub needed to be trimmed a bit on the sides and rear. stitchdup Posted December 31, 2016 Author Share Posted December 31, 2016 Looks great! Great paint and interior. Did you do a WIP on this? If not, I have three questions. One, how did you do the roof? Two, how did you do the interior? And three, what did you use for chrome?There is a WIP, but it's on another forum. The roof was laced by placing some lace on the top of it and dusting on some paint (I use spray cans so it's a little thick) the seats are sewing thread on double sided tape which was then cut to fit, and the chrome is a mix of the kit supplied bits and BMF ultrabrite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
